Winchmore Hill station is well-equipped for ticket purchasing and collection, boasting a ticket office and machines.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:50 to 13:15, and Saturday from 08:30 to 14:00. For those planning digitally, online tickets can be collected directly from the ticket machines.
Accessibility features are present, although the station does not offer step-free access. However, there are accessible ticket machines available, compatible with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. For those requiring additional assistance, staff are on hand and can be booked in advance for a smoother travel experience. Note that waiting room facilities and accessible toilets are not available, although seating areas are provided.

Wandsworth Common station prides itself on being user-friendly with a plethora of facilities. The ticket office operates from early mornings to nearly midnight, offering flexibility for your travel plans. If buying tickets in advance suits you better, pick them up at the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a thoughtful addition here, with induction loops and Disabled Persons Railcard-enabled ticket machines ensuring ease for everyone.
While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ms, you can find seating areas to relax before catching your train. Safety is prioritized through the presence of CCTV, and while luggage storage is unavailable, the staff offers assistance for those who need help navigating the station. The charming simplicity of Wandsworth is slightly amplified by a free 24-hour parking service managed by APCOA Parking UK, with space for 25 vehicles, including one accessible spot.

For the cycle enthusiasts, the station offers 66 bicycle storage spaces, sheltered and monitored by CCTV. While there's no cycle hire available on-site, it's easy to meander through the picturesque streets of Wandsworth by renting a bike nearby.
